Cartman308,

Don't rule out the PVT until you've tried it. I almost did. My extensive snowmobile experience made me look twice and it was sure worth it. It is awesome.

Yes, you can get the belt wet but you have to try really, really hard. Our group of 4 Sportsman's hasn't done it yet. If you do, it delays you for about 30 seconds while the belt self dries. No big deal, no harn done. If you really wanted a submarine, but bought an ATV, you can snorkel the air intake to protect it more. In 99.8% of the cases I would say this is not required.

My snowmobiles will ingest powder snow and wet the belt if I am diving hard into the drifts. Minor delay for drying and I am on my way again.

I agree, Polaris could, and should, offer more models in a standard. Just wanted to say don't rule out the PVT because of the fear mongering you read about here. If both machines are available, my Four-Trax will sit idle while the Sportsman with the PVT and IRS goes rid'in.
